Hiking in Dolomites Map: Exploring the Trails

When it comes to hiking in the Dolomites, there are endless possibilities. The region is home to a vast network of trails, ranging from easy walks to challenging multi-day hikes. Some of the most popular trails include the Alta Via routes, which traverse the entire Dolomite range, and the Tre Cime di Lavaredo loop, which offers stunning views of the iconic three peaks.

Regardless of your hiking abilities, there is a trail for everyone in the Dolomites. Whether you're looking for a leisurely stroll through alpine meadows or an adrenaline-pumping ascent to a mountain summit, the Dolomites have it all. With a hiking map in hand, you can explore the trails at your own pace and discover the beauty of this unique mountain range.

Tips for Hiking in Dolomites Map

Here are some tips to help you make the most of your hiking experience in the Dolomites:

  • Be prepared for changing weather conditions. The Dolomites are known for their unpredictable weather, so make sure to pack layers and be prepared for rain or snow.
  • Stay hydrated and pack plenty of snacks. Hiking in the mountains can be physically demanding, so it's important to stay nourished and energized.
  • Wear appropriate footwear. The trails in the Dolomites can be steep and rocky, so make sure to wear sturdy hiking boots that provide ankle support.
  • Respect the environment. The Dolomites are a UNESCO World Heritage site and are home to a fragile ecosystem. Make sure to follow Leave No Trace principles and leave the trails as you found them.

Q: What is the best time to hike in the Dolomites?

A: The best time to hike in the Dolomites is during the summer months, from June to September. During this time, the weather is generally mild, and the trails are accessible. However, it's important to be prepared for changing weather conditions, as the mountains can be unpredictable.
